The Mongols were a mix of Turkic and Tungusic groups from north-eastern Central Asia and East Asia. They're like, the product of a crazy family reunion, with Indo-Iranian tribes, proto-Mongol groups, and other weird relatives thrown into the mix, ya feel?
Their epic origin story is like, straight out of a fantasy novel! The Secret History of the Mongols says they came from over the 'Tengis' - a sea or lake - 22 generations before Genghis Khan's birth in 1162. But, like, scholars can't agree on which lake it is, fam! Is it Lake Baikal in Siberia or Lake Hulun in Inner Mongolia? The debate is real, bro!
The Early Days
So, the Mongols were just one of many tribes in the region, chillin' along the River Erguna, which is now the Sino-Russian border, you dig? They were part of the Shiwei people, and one of their tribes, the Meng-wu, Meng-ku, or Mongols, was like, the cool kids on the block, fam!
Their leaders were like, straight fire! Dobu Mergen, Bodonchar Munkhag, and Khaidu Khan were some of the OG ancestors, bruh! They were all about buildin' empires and crushin' enemies, and they laid the groundwork for the Borjigin clan, which would eventually produce the most iconic leader in Mongol history - Genghis Khan!
The Rise of Genghis Khan
Temujin, aka Genghis Khan, was born in 1162, and his life was like, a rollercoaster, fam! His dad, Yesugei, was poisoned by the Tartars, and he had to fight to survive, bruh! He built alliances, gathered a crew, and took down the Tartars, makin' himself the supreme khan in 1206, at the ripe age of 44!
He was like, the ultimate warrior-chief, and his empire would stretch from China to Eastern Europe, fam! He was the OG unifier, and his legacy would live on for centuries, bruh!
